Transaction ab6ffef8979a7218f8eae1de26ba672b761620ce6b5768fe0fb78d03a2584140

1 Input
2 Outputs
  • ab6ffef8979a7218f8eae1de26ba672b761620ce6b5768fe0fb78d03a2584140:0
  • value  66245710
    address  137JyLnAf4ygQtuSzKWQnC4ZxR2aiH3xWa
  • ab6ffef8979a7218f8eae1de26ba672b761620ce6b5768fe0fb78d03a2584140:1
  • value  441106
    address  3HBGF9By99EeDcwfwhRgkouLPBmp2U9yJN